2024 Shorty's Dining Room

True lovers of the blue and grey can pay homage to the man who helped start it all, North Queensland Toyota Cowboys inaugural chairman, Ron ‘Shorty’ McLean.

A refined and relaxed space with an outstanding view of the field, Shorty’s offers the perfect location to deep dive into the merits of the game over a cold beverage.

Shorty’s is the true inner sanctum, whether hosting a dedicated table of friends, family or colleagues, or making new connections with those as passionate as you about the game.

Features

  • Access to a private air-conditioned dining room atop the Western grandstand at your chosen Cowboys home game/s at Queensland Country Bank Stadium
  • Bistro style dining and premium beverage options available for purchase
  • Ability to entertain guests at your own table or connect with others at a mixed table
  • Reserved seat in the Western grandstand in front of the function room
  • Dedicated corporate entrance at Queensland Country Bank Stadium
  • Television monitors and internal radio broadcast of the match

*Catering (food and beverages) not included and additional to the price.
